Make It Mercer Again: Special Consideration Program for Business

2.8.22 | 5:30pm - 6:30pm

Did you know? Mercer undergraduate students may be eligible for special admission consideration for a graduate business program through the University’s Special Consideration Program. Eligible students can take advantage of waivers for both the GMAT requirement and the application fee, and enjoy additional benefits including a 30% tuition benefit toward earning their graduate business degree at Mercer.
